区块链技术是近年来备受关注的热门话题,其背后的密码学原理支撑着安全性、透明性及去中心化等核心特性。在区块链系统中,密码并不仅仅指代某种特定的编码或算法,而是涵盖了多种加密技术和数学原理。本文将深入探讨区块链中的密码到底是什么,以及其在维护区块链安全性中的作用。
区块链是一种分布式账本技术,数据在网络中以块的形式存储。每个块中包含一定数量的交易记录,并通过密码学的哈希函数与前一个块相连接,形成链式结构。这样的设计确保了数据的不可篡改性和透明性。在区块链中,密码学是保障数据安全的重要手段。
密码学是区块链技术的基石,它为用户提供了一系列安全保障,包括身份认证、数据完整性、机密性,以及抵抗伪造和篡改的能力。主要通过以下几种方式实现:
哈希函数将任意长度的数据输入转化为固定长度的输出,这个输出被称为哈希值。在区块链中,每个区块都包含前一个块的哈希值,这样便形成了一个密码学上的“链条”。如果任何一个块的数据被修改,其哈希值便会改变,从而使后续的所有块都失效,这一特性极大地提高了区块链的安全性。
在区块链中,对称加密和非对称加密各有其应用。对称加密使用同一个密钥进行加密和解密,适用于数据传输的过程。而非对称加密(如RSA加密)则使用一对密钥(公钥和私钥),用户可以用公钥加密数据,只有持有相应私钥的人才能解密。这使得手续费、身份确认等应用场景变得更加安全。
为了保证交易的合法性,区块链利用数字签名技术来验证用户的身份。用户在发起交易时,用自己的私钥对交易信息进行签名,其他节点在接收到信息后,可以用用户的公钥来验证签名的有效性。这一过程确保只有交易的发起者才能操作其资产,有效地防止了双重支付的问题。
共识机制是区块链网络参与者就交易的有效性达成一致的方式。各种共识机制(如工作量证明PoW、权益证明PoS等)都依赖于复杂的数学算法和密码学原理来维护网络的安全性和稳定性。通过有效的共识机制,区块链能够防止恶意用户篡改数据,确保网络的安全和公正。
区块链不仅仅是一种技术,它还代表了一种新的价值观——去中心化。通过利用密码学,区块链能够在没有中介的情况下实现信任与合作,从而改变传统行业的运作模式。无论是金融、物流、身份验证,还是版权保护等领域,区块链都展现出了其潜在的应用价值。
区块链技术虽具有诸多优势,但也存在一些不可忽视的缺点。例如:
1. 资源消耗:特别是在工作量证明机制下,区块链的挖矿过程需要消耗大量计算资源和电力。
2. 吞吐量现有的区块链技术在并发处理能力上有限,可能导致交易确认延迟。
3. 法律和合规:区块链的去中心化特性可能使得现有法律体系难以适应,为其应用带来一定的法律风险。
4. 用户教育:普及区块链技术需要一定的教育和培训,以便用户能够理解和正确应用这一新兴技术。
密码学是区块链安全的重要保障,但也面临以下挑战:
1. 算法的安全性:随着计算能力的提升,某些加密算法可能会面临被破解的风险。必须持续开发和升级加密算法以应对新威胁。
2. 溢出和碰撞:在哈希函数中,碰撞现象(不同输入产生相同输出)是一个危险信号,应尽可能避免。
3. 密钥管理:用户需妥善管理私钥,一旦丢失或被盗,数字资产将无法找回。
4. 量子计算威胁:未来的量子计算机可能会威胁现有密码学的安全,需要开发抗量子计算的加密算法。
数字货币的安全性主要依赖于以下几个方面:
1. 交易过程的加密传输:使用加密协议确保交易信息在网络中传输时不被窃取或篡改。
2. 多重签名机制:对重要交易进行多重签名,增加资金安全性。
3. 安全钱包:使用硬件钱包等安全存储设备,降低数字货币被盗或丢失的风险。
4. 社区监督:区块链的透明性使得任何人都可以参与监督,社区的广泛参与增加了安全性。
未来区块链技术的发展趋势可能包括:
1. 更多行业应用:随着技术的成熟,区块链将渗透至金融、医疗、物流等多个行业。
2. 扩展性与互操作性:不同区块链之间的互通与兼容将成为关键,提升系统整体效率。
3. 法规和合规框架的建立:针对区块链技术的监管政策将逐步完善,以促进行业健康发展。
4. 隐私保护技术:随着隐私保护意识增加,零知识证明等新技术将在区块链中得到更多应用。
区块链技术可能对社会产生深远的影响:
1. 提升透明度:区块链的公开透明特性有助于增强公众对各类交易及信息的信任。
2. 赋权用户:去中心化的系统使得用户可以自主控制自己的数据和资产,减少对中介的依赖。
3. 改变商业模式:区块链将促成新的商业模式的产生,特别是在金融科技和供应链管理等领域。
4. 疫情带来的启示:在全球疫情背景下,区块链在疫苗追踪、供应链管理等方面展现出了独特的价值。
总之,区块链技术的不断发展及其背后的密码学原理,在重塑诸多行业的同时,也为人类社会的信任机制带来了新的思考。随着技术的成熟,我们有理由相信,区块链将在未来更加深入地融入我们的生活。
2003-2025 tp官方APP正版下载 @版权所有|网站地图|鄂ICP备12008415号